Various important to leaders -as Ghosn- known worldwide; are characterized by different leaderships style. The most frequently observed leadership styles are represented by autocratic or authoritarian, participative or democratic, laissez-faire, narcissistic, and toxic leadership. The autocratic leadership style assumes that the leader makes all decisions (Leadership Expert, 2010). In other words, the decision-making process is a centralized by one person. Leaders with this style do not have close relationships with their subordinates. In Mr. Ghosn case, he has the opposite approach; he encourages his initiative, and he is interested in discussing their assistant’s ideas (Hellriegel, Slocum, & Jackson, 2008). Moreover, there are several advantages associated with his leadership style, as it provides great motivation for Ghosn to maximize the using of mental human resources for his subordinates that he has in the both companies. These advantages rely on the fact that Ghosn in this case can make effective decisions by discuss many ideas with other stakeholders. The participative leadership style here is quite the opposite of the autocratic style. Consultation and participation of the group is very important for democratic leaders such as Mr. Ghosn focus on cooperation of his subordinates.
